Elevator Platforms[1] are platforms that appear only in Super Mario Advance. They are disguised as short, hill-like Semisolid Platforms, but when they are landed on, they bounce upward, which can help Mario and company reach higher places. There are only two in the entire game. The first appears early in World 1-1. The second is found in World 1-3 under the third Ace Coin.
